AWESOME DINNER ROLLS
"These are truly awesome. Very, very light and delicious. I wish I knew who the original author was so that I could give proper credit to this truly wonderful recipe."
1 cup warm water
2 tablespoons butter, softened
1 egg
3 1/4 cups bread flour
1/4 cup sugar
1 teaspoon salt
3 teaspoons yeast
Melted butter (for brushing tops)
Put ingredients in the bread pan in order directed by your manufacturer. Set for DOUGH cycle.
When finished, pull the dough apart into about 12 balls. Place on a greased cookie sheet 2-inches apart and brush with melted butter. Cover and set in a warm place to rise for about 30-40 minutes or until nearly doubled in size. (I let mine rise longer than called for with no adverse reaction.)
Bake at 350 degrees F for approximately 30 minutes or until lightly golden brown (mine usually take only about 20 minutes). Remove from the oven and brush with melted butter again. Serve warm.
Makes 12 dinner rolls
